1

我搜索了很多,我似乎找不到任何与在 Java 中将字符串转换为固定长度字节相关的内容,我不知道这是否可能,因为我们已经得到了编码。

String word = "asdsda";
byte[] bytes = Java.Convert(word, 20);

正如上面的示例所示,Java 中有没有办法将字符串转换为固定的正字节值?

4

2 回答 2

1
String word = "asdsda";
byte[] bytes = word.getBytes("UTF-8");

会给你6个字节。

于 2013-06-24T01:14:39.793 回答
0

字符编码是有规则的,字符到字节的转换,必须在某些编码规则的约束下,否则毫无意义

于 2013-06-24T01:34:29.230 回答